MEMO — Branch Managers, from Ops Finance, Tarnwell Appliances

Quick heads-up: warranty claims on the Fenbrook dryer line are running well over budget this quarter, mostly drum bearings. Hold off on goodwill repairs beyond policy until the review wraps. Jorun's team will circulate revised claim guidance Friday. For context, here's the confidential note on our plans.

confidential, yahip-hagug: Gorixax Logistics plans to lower the Ulaael list price by 26.6 percent in October. The pricing group signed off on a budget of $199.9 million for Project Holix. The renewal with Kasdorox Systems closes at $137.5 million a year, 8.2 percent above the last contract. Project Lamion slips by a full year because of the audit delay.

**Alert: FANOUT_BACKPRESSURE_HIGH**

Fires when the Skerrit notification fan-out queue depth exceeds 50k for five minutes. Usually means a slow push provider or a stuck shard consumer. Impact: delayed user notifications, no data loss. First move: check shard lag, then provider latency dashboards. Do not scale workers blindly — it amplifies provider throttling. The full mitigation procedure is on the page below.

runbook for tajep-yahig: https://artifactory.lumictech.corp/repo

## Deploying the Gatewick Proctor Queue

Deploys are pretty painless: push to main, wait for the pipeline, then watch the queue drain dashboard for five minutes. If candidates pile up mid-exam, roll back first and ask questions later — the queue replays safely. Everything the workers care about lives in one config block, shown here for reference.

settings of bafof-yagef:
JOROX_PIN=8740
JOROX_TENANT=pelox
JOROX_METRICS_HOST=metrics.jorox.qorvelworks.internal
JOROX_SEAL=seal_c78f63c1
JOROX_STANDBY_TEAM=norax

Handover note — Crumbwheel order cutoffs.

Welcome aboard. The bakery cutoff rule in Crumbwheel closes same-day orders at 14:00 local to each storefront, not UTC — this has bitten us twice. Holiday overrides live in the calendar service and take precedence silently, so always check there first when a cutoff looks wrong. To unlock the calendar service's admin console after a restart, enter the recovery passphrase below.

vault phrase of bagap-bahaf = silion-pelox-sorox-casdor-quenwyn-fraax-eliox-praael-kelion-quenvan-kasox-rusael-norius-belvan